Roger Beckett Date: 10/13/10 22:02 Re: PS&P question Author: funnelfan I was up there last Wednesday and the ex-NS and two FEC units arrived northbound in Shelton at 2pm, dropped a few cars at Shelton and then went up to Bayshore and put away three LPG tanks and many garbage containers on two tracks. They went light power back to Shelton and tied down on a track adjacent to the mainline, hopped in a van and left. I believe the two ex-CAL northern GP15's based at Shelton were going to be used the next morning to take the cars at Bayshore to their industries up closer to Bremerton. I haven't been able to nail down the operations on that line as they seem to keep changing it. I do know that Thursday is the day to catch the train coming south out of Shelton because that is the day when they haul the most lumber and garbage making for a monster train.
